I replaced the O2 sensor in my 90 C2 Cab and noticed a second sensor of some sort toward the back of the catalytic converter. I called two Porsche dealers to help identify the part. Niello thinks it is a cat temp sensor, but can't get that part because they think it was only used on the p-cars kept in country. Sportique (Russ) says he's not sure if he can get the part, but will call Porsche in Germany if necessary and let me know tomorrow.
My question is; Do I need this? I have a slight exhaust leak from where this sensor attaches to the cat so I would like to replace the sensor to fix said leak or if I don't need it I can remove it and replace with a screw in plug. BTW: I have a diagram of the exhaust system that Russ faxed to me that I can scan if it would help, otherwise here's a pic of the p-car. Thank you in advance, Gary ![]() |
